Maid2Clean is looking for part-time self-employed cleaners in Lancaster, Lancashire. Enjoy the flexibility of being your own boss while we manage client coordination and admin. You will clean homes and receive cash payments on the same day.
This role offers 4–30+ hours of work per week, allowing you to keep 100% of your earnings while providing full insurance support. An entry-level position, suitable for those looking for flexible hours in consumer services.
